DESCRIPTION

TheTIP132isasiliconEpitaxial-BaseNPN

powertransistorinmonolithicDarlington

configuration,mountedinJedecTO-220plastic

package.Itisintentedforuseinpowerlinearand

switchingapplications.

ThecomplementaryPNPtypeisTIP137.

AlsoTIP135isaPNPtype.®
